Troy: Good to talk to you on the phone the other day. You said you were going to switch from NaOH to KOH and would try to find someone to buy the NaOH from you. What about building your own "hot-tank"? NaOH is what I use in mine, have for 30 years. 12.5 lbs NaOH per 100 gal water, heat to 180 deg F...........instant Hot-tank! It will strip all the paint and grease off anything made of Iron, and if you use a 2 amp battery charger hooked to it, it will strip off all the rust too!
